The Dutch, Swedes, and Finns traveled across the North Atlantic Ocean and settled along the Delaware River and Bay in Delaware.
Upon arrival they built forts, like the one pictured here, to protect themselves from intruders and to claim a piece of land. Do you have what it takes to create a fort?